背景需求 在面向对象的设计中,典型如Java语言,为了控制对象属性的修改入口,我们常用的做法是把属性设置为private,然后通过getter和setter方法访问、修改该属性。 但是在Pytho ...
PyCharm 是很多 Python 开发者优先选择的 IDE,功能强大,跨平台,提供免费社区版,非常良心。如果你想自己给PyCharm添加一些功能怎么办呢 有两个办法: 通过提需求实现,到 JetBrains 的github去提issue或者自己发Pull Request请他们merge。 通过安装插件实现,你可以查找现有的插件仓库,或者,自己写一个。 今天我们说说怎么搭建环境自己写一个 PyC ...
2017-12-29 14:18 0 2031 推荐指数:
背景需求 在面向对象的设计中,典型如Java语言,为了控制对象属性的修改入口,我们常用的做法是把属性设置为private,然后通过getter和setter方法访问、修改该属性。 但是在Pytho ...
maven是当下最流行的项目管理工具,其丰富的插件为我们的工作带来了很大的便利。 但是在一些情况下,开源的插件并不能完全满足我们的需求,我们需要自己创建插件,本文就从0开始带大家一起创建自己的插件。 【命名规范】 首先,官方的命名规范是maven-xxx-plugin,为了避免于官方冲突 ...
开发一个shopify插件,shopify商城可以安装该插件;当用户在商城下单后,插件把订单数据按照指定格式传给disruptsports服务器; https://help.shopify.com/api/tutorials ...
参考文章:Remote Debugging Guide for Python PyQGIS CookBook 16.4. IDE settings for writing and debugging plugins Remote Debugging with PyCharm 一、检查 ...
安装微信开发插件 第一步 第二步 第三步 查看结果 wxml wxss ...
前言 Vue 项目开发过程中,经常用到插件,比如原生插件 vue-router、vuex,还有 element-ui 提供的 notify、message 等等。这些插件让我们的开发变得更简单更高效。那么 Vue 插件是怎么开发的呢?如何自己开发一个 Vue 插件然后打包发布到npm? 本文 ...
偶然在博客园中了解到这种技术,顺便学习了几天。 以下是搜索到一些比较好的博文供参考: MEF核心笔记 《MEF程序设计指南》博文汇总 先上效果图 一、新建解决方案 开始新建一个解决方案Mef,再添加一个winform项目为:MefDemo 如图 ...
本文针对于谷歌浏览器,不过其它浏览器插件大同小异 首先,我们需要创建一个文件夹,命名随意 然后,我们需要创建一个manifest.json的文件,命名必须要这个,这个是谷歌内核浏览器的入口类配置文件 里面内容大概是这样 文件夹里内容的截图 一切弄完,那么该怎么上传这个插件 ...